Capacity note: the Dunmore nightly reindex runs with a fixed worker pool and bounded batch sizes to keep memory and I/O within the audited envelope. No credentials are cached between batches, and throughput ceilings prevent resource exhaustion on shared hosts. For review, the enforced constants are listed below.

tuning constants:
RATE_LIMITS = {
    "wenwyn": 1,
    "zorix": 10,
    "oliix": 2,
    "holael": 10,
}

Subject: VRAM profiler cut-over done

Maintainers — the switch from the old MemTrace hooks to the new Skarn profiler is complete across the Ordovine training fleet. Sampling now happens in-driver, overhead is under 2%, and allocation snapshots land in the shared bucket hourly. Old hooks are removed; do not re-enable them. Dashboards were repointed last night. Everything you need to reproduce the deployed state is in the configuration below.

config for tagep-yajef:
ulawyn:
  log_level: error
  metrics_host: metrics.ulawyn.lumiclabs.internal
  pin: 0564
  pool_size: 32

Usually it's the conflict resolver picking the stale copy after a timezone edit. Don't run the brute-force resync first — it multiplies duplicates. Instead, find the affected series, clear its sync token, and let the incremental pass heal it. If more than ~50 users are hit, page the sync team. Step-by-step commands and known edge cases are on the page below.

wiki page, hahif-hahif: https://argocd.kelvisys.corp/browse/board/settings/pages/1442e0b1065d83f1

Ticket: Config drift in Lanternwick rollout framework. The staging evaluator for our feature-flag service has diverged from the checked-in manifest — someone hand-edited rollout percentages during last week's incident and never committed. New team members: never edit flags directly on the host; all changes go through the Lanternwick repo. To restore parity, apply the values shown below.

settings of fafog-haduf:
ZORIX_PIN=4648
ZORIX_METRICS_HOST=metrics.zorix.paliqsys.corp
ZORIX_LOG_LEVEL=info
ZORIX_TENANT=druix